If your business employs no more than 25 full-time equivalent employees, the average annual wage of each employee is $50,000 or less, and you pay health insurance premiums for those employees, you may qualify for a refundable tax credit of as much as 35% (25% for tax-exempt organizations) of the insurance premiums.
